Fastapi File Browser, Simple file browser with fastapi.

Fastapi File Browser, Here are the key takeaways: File Handling: We explored different methods of handling file uploads and downloads, covering various scenarios Build robust file download endpoints in FastAPI. By default, fastapi dev will start with A practical guide to serving file downloads in FastAPI - from simple static files to streaming large datasets and generating files on the fly. Learn to build your first REST API with FastAPI in Python, a step-by-step guide covering installation, routing, data validation, and automatic documentation. Hope you will be able to use it in concrete Thus, if the file is too large to fit into your server's RAM, you should rather read the file in chunks and process one chunk at a time, as described in The get_etag function implementation is inspired by how FastAPI (actually Starlette) calculates it in their source code to return it in the FileResponse Etag header. Contribute to wxgaidj/file_browser development by creating an account on GitHub. Item Description Video Frame Extractor is a complete, production-ready web application that extracts high-quality JPEG frames from any video file. Make sure you create a virtual environment, activate it, and then install it, for example: This is because uploaded files are sent as "form data". We will walk through the code provided and explain each step in detail, demonstrating how Risk Portal A FastAPI-based portfolio risk dashboard that fetches market data with yfinance, calculates core risk metrics, stores analyses in SQLite, and renders results in a browser dashboard. py file automatically, detects the FastAPI app in it, and starts a server using Uvicorn. Build robust file download endpoints in FastAPI. tt5xngf, qub, dt3go, f2wfyzy, 6on5, tlp9wnk, zvf1t7, fo5vc, dy90, 6tgg,